エクスポート (0) 印刷
すべて展開

BeginDefer メソッド (Guid, AsyncCallback, Object)

メッセージの処理を中断する非同期操作を開始します。

名前空間:  Microsoft.ServiceBus.Messaging
アセンブリ:  Microsoft.ServiceBus (Microsoft.ServiceBus.dll)

public IAsyncResult BeginDefer(
	Guid lockToken,
	AsyncCallback callback,
	Object state
)

パラメーター

lockToken
型: System..::..Guid
ロックされたメッセージ インスタンスにバインドされているロック トークン。
callback
型: System..::..AsyncCallback
操作が完了したときに呼び出すメソッドを参照する AsyncCallback デリゲート。
state
型: System..::..Object
非同期操作に関する状態情報を含むユーザー定義のオブジェクト。

戻り値

型: System..::..IAsyncResult
メッセージの処理を中断する非同期操作を参照する IAsyncResult

例外条件
TimeoutException

操作の所要時間が OperationTimeout で設定されたタイムアウト値を超えた場合にスローされます。

OperationCanceledException

クライアント エンティティが終了したか中止されていた場合にスローされます。

MessageLockLostException

lockToken で示されるメッセージのロックが失われた場合にスローされます。

コミュニティの追加

追加
表示:
© 2014 Microsoft